What are the risks associated with smart contract vulnerabilities?
Smart contract hacks typically exploit coding flaws, logic errors, or insufficient testing, leading to unauthorized asset theft or manipulation. These incidents are irreversible due to the immutable nature of blockchain ledgers, making recovery difficult or impossible.
Investors face significant risks, including fund loss and eroded trust in projects that lack transparent development practices or regular security audits according to industry analysis.
How are security frameworks evolving to address these risks?
Innovations like SmartGraphical are enhancing the detection of logical vulnerabilities by combining static analysis with graphical modeling and human-in-the-loop verification. This hybrid approach allows developers to inspect control flows and identify vulnerabilities that traditional methods might miss as research shows.

What are the broader implications for investors and the blockchain industry?
The increased complexity of blockchain systems and the growing number of tokenized assets mean that smart contract security is a foundational concern. Projects that fail to implement best practices risk exposing users to exploitation and reputational damage.
Investors should prioritize projects that demonstrate a commitment to security through documented practices, audits, and transparency. The market is likely to reward projects with strong security records, while those with vulnerabilities may face significant financial and reputational consequences.
The future of blockchain adoption will depend heavily on the industry's ability to address security risks. As more enterprises and institutions invest in blockchain solutions, the demand for secure, auditable, and transparent smart contracts will continue to rise. Developers, researchers, and investors must collaborate to ensure the long-term viability of decentralized technologies.
